Abstract
We consider deuteron formation in heavy ion collisions at intermediate energies. The elementary reaction rates (Nd -> NNN) in this context are calculated using rigorous Faddeev methods. To this end an in-medium Faddeev equation that consistently includes the energy shift and Pauli blocking effects has been derived and solved numerically. As a first application we have calculated the life-time of deuteron fluctuations for nuclear densities and temperatures typical for the final stage of heavy ion collisions. We find substantial differences between using the isolated and the in-medium rates.
